[Vmdebootstrap-devel] [PATCH 3/3] use deboostraps default mirror by default
Jan Gerber
j at mailb.org
Mon Oct 13 10:17:22 UTC 2014
deboostrap already picks the right mirror based on
the distribution. no need to pass this by default.
---
vmdebootstrap | 8 +++++---
1 file changed, 5 insertions(+), 3 deletions(-)
diff --git a/vmdebootstrap b/vmdebootstrap
index 199b311..5fb011e 100755
--- a/vmdebootstrap
+++ b/vmdebootstrap
@@ -60,9 +60,9 @@ class VmDebootstrap(cliapp.Application):
self.settings.string(['tarball'], "tar up the disk's contents in FILE",
metavar='FILE')
self.settings.string(['mirror'],
- 'use MIRROR as package source (%default)',
+ 'use MIRROR as package source instead of debootstraps default',
metavar='URL',
- default='http://cdn.debian.net/debian/')
+ default='')
self.settings.string(['arch'], 'architecture to use (%default)',
metavar='ARCH',
default=default_arch)
@@ -318,7 +318,9 @@ class VmDebootstrap(cliapp.Application):
args.append('--variant')
args.append(self.settings['variant'])
args += [self.settings['distribution'],
- rootdir, self.settings['mirror']]
+ rootdir]
+ if self.settings['mirror']:
+ args += [self.settings['mirror']]
logging.debug(" ".join(args))
self.runcmd(args)
if self.settings['foreign']:
--
2.1.1
More information about the Vmdebootstrap-devel
mailing list